Should you visit the tallest or the biggest trees in the world? Do you know the difference between redwoods and sequoias? The author's first encounter with one of the largest trees on Earth was by accident in Yosemite’s Mariposa Grove, where they stumbled upon the now-fallen Wawona Tree, a giant sequoia with a wagon tunnel carved through it in 1881.
Since then, the author has learned more about California’s natural giants—the massive giant sequoia and the towering coast redwood—and where to find the most extraordinary ones, such as the General Sherman Tree in Sequoia National Park, with a trunk roughly three times the volume of a blue whale.
